What is Cube Root?
Cube root is a mathematical operation used to find the number that, when multiplied by itself three times, gives the original number. For example, the cube root of 27 is 3 because 3 x 3 x 3 = 27. Similarly, the cube root of 64 is 4 because 4 x 4 x 4 = 64. In simple terms, the cube root of a number is the opposite of cubing a number.

What is the difference between cube root and square root?
The cube root and square root are both types of radical functions that involve finding the root of a number. However, the cube root finds the number that, when cubed, gives the original number, while the square root finds the number that, when squared, gives the original number. For example:
- The cube root of 27 is 3, because 3 x 3 x 3 = 27.
- The square root of 25 is 5, because 5 x 5 = 25.
